Abstract:
An electronic device including: an image sensor including plural sensors divided into groups; a multi-lens array including plural lenses configured to each form an image of a scene on a distinct group of the groups of pixel sensors; and a filter including plural color filter elements arranged in rows and columns. Each color filter element is associated with one of the lenses and the respective distinct group and configured to filter an image of the scene into one of plural color channels. A first group of pixel sensors can define a perspective of the scene for an image reconstruction, and the color filter elements in the row of the color filter element corresponding to the first group and the color filter elements in the column of the color filter element corresponding to the first group can filter the image of the scene into each of the plural color channels.

Abstract:
The present disclosure generally pertains to an imaging apparatus for computed tomography imaging spectroscopy, which has circuitry configured to:
obtain object image data being representative of light stemming from an object and being subject to an optical path and to a multiplexing process caused by a diffraction grating; and perform a spectral density reconstruction from an image of the object by inputting the obtained object image data into an spectral density reconstruction algorithm being configured to numerically solve a first equation describing the transformation of the light stemming from the object caused by the optical path into the object image based on a reduction of a dimensionality of a first function indicative of the optical path based on a symmetry of the first function, thereby reconstructing the spectral density of the object.

Abstract:
A reflectometer has a depth sensor which obtains distance information between the depth sensor and an object, a light source which emits light having a calibrated light spectrum, a spectral sensor which collects spectral information from light reflected from the object, and a circuitry. The circuitry calculates a reflectance spectrum for the object based on the distance information and the spectral information collected from light being reflected from the object, wherein the light originates from the light source.

Abstract:
The present disclosure pertains to a wafer level lens stack, which has a substrate, a first, a second lens and an actuator. The substrate has a first side and a second side. The second side is opposite to the first side. The first lens is on the first side of the substrate. The second lens is on the second side of the substrate and the second lens can change its refraction characteristic. The actuator can change the refraction characteristic of the second lens.
